Job Summary:

The Georgia Department of Education is seeking an experienced Audiologist to join our team. As an Audiologist, you will be responsible for assessing and treating children with hearing loss, fitting and dispensing hearing aids, and providing support for auditory training.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Administer and interpret comprehensive auditory evaluations to assess hearing loss in children.
  • Collaborate with physicians and other health and educational personnel to develop treatment plans.
  • Assess the need for and recommend auditory rehabilitation, including medical referrals, amplification needs, and associated therapeutic intervention.
  • Counsel clients and families on evaluation findings and recommendations.
  • Communicate effectively with referral sources and families to ensure seamless care.
  • Dispense recommended assistive equipment, such as hearing aids.
  • Maintain accurate and detailed client records throughout the evaluation and treatment process.
  • Monitor progress and adjust treatment recommendations in collaboration with families and healthcare professionals.
  • Prepare reports on diagnostic findings, treatment used, and client progress.
  • Stay up-to-date on documentation requirements for authorization and billing purposes.
  • Participate in public information events and educational programs to promote the Georgia Mobile Audiology Program and State Schools Outreach.
  • Provide education and consultation to staff, school personnel, and community stakeholders on auditory disorders and their implications for social/emotional and language development.
  • Participate in research studies and present findings at conferences.
  • Supervise graduate students in Audiology and evaluate their performance.

Requirements:

  • Doctorate or Master's degree in Speech-Language Pathology or Audiology from an accredited institution.
  • One year of experience as an Audiologist or equivalent position.
  • Current Georgia licensure and/or certification to practice in the area of assignment.

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Three years of experience as an Audiologist with pediatric diagnostic and hearing assistive technology experience.
  • Knowledge of federal, state, and local regulations pertaining to audiological services.
  • Experience with supervision of audiology technicians, assistants, and/or students.
